Definition
Other clerical support workers sort and deliver mail, file documents, prepare information for processing, maintain personnel records, check material for consistency with original source material, assist persons who cannot read or write, and perform various other specialized clerical duties. Competent performance in most occupations in this sub-major group requires skills at the second ISCO skill level.
Tasks include
Tasks performed by workers in this sub-major group usually include: recording information regarding acquisition, issue and return of library books; classifying and filing various documents and other records; maintaining personnel records; sorting, recording and delivering mail from post offices, as well as from or within an enterprise; coding; correcting proofs; performing a range of miscellaneous clerical duties; writing on behalf of persons who are unable to read or write.
Included occupations or child groups
Occupations in this sub-major group are classified into the following minor group: 441 Other Clerical Support Workers
